Maven: add a folder or jar file into current classpath


I am using maven-compile plugin to compile classes. Now I would like to add one jar file into the current classpath. That file stays in another location (let's say c:/jars/abc.jar . I prefer to leave this file here). How can I do that?

If I use classpath in the argument:

<configuration>
 <compilerArguments>
  <classpath>c:/jars/abc.jar</classpath>
 </compilerArguments>
</configuration>

it will not work because it will override the current classpath (that includes all the dependencies)


Solution

  • This might have been asked before. See Can I add jars to maven 2 build classpath without installing them?

    In a nutshell: include your jar as dependency with system scope. This requires specifying the absolute path to the jar.
